The Luna OBR 4600 Optical Backscatter Reflectometer (OBR) is a powerful tool for testing and analyzing loss in short-run networks and components.
The OBR 4600 is an ultra-high resolution reflectometer that features a spatial sampling resolution of 10 microns, zero dead zone, and backscatter-level sensitivity. The OBR 4600 offers industry leading technology to precisely track loss and polarization states, allowing you to “see inside” your components and systems.

The T‑Gauge® Control Unit (TCU) is the central component of the T‑Gauge® family of products and serves as the source of the optical and electrical signals necessary to generate and detect terahertz. The TCU also transforms analog data into a digital signal that can be analyzed using the onboard processor and interacts with the wide variety of THz accessories.
-
The TCU is a 19 inch (483 mm) rack, wall, or table mountable instrument, consisting of an ultrafast laser, high-speed optical delay, ranging optical delay, power supplies, and signal conditioning electronics, with connectors for convenient interfacing to various optical and electronic components. The high-speed delay included in the TCU can be chosen from a number of delay length and speed options. When utilized in conjunction with T-Gauge® accessories, the TCU enables the user to generate and detect pulsed terahertz energy for a wide variety of measurements.

Luna Innovations mission is to help advance the continuing increase in data transmission rates for the public & private communications network with high speed optical receivers and test products, while also leveraging our unique fiber optic sensing technology to improve the structural testing of new composite elements and components in new aircraft and automobiles.
Luna Innovations Incorporated (NASDAQ: LUNA) was founded in 1990 and has been successful in taking innovative technologies from the applied research stage to product development and ultimately to the commercial market. In some cases, the successes led to the creation of independent businesses. We have created companies in our area of focus, sold some of them to industry leaders in their fields, raised private capital, formed joint ventures and entered into a number of licensing agreements.
